Knowing the definite characteristics, behavior and Powder flow properties are of the utmost importance in various industries such as the pharmaceutical industry. This information is vital because it helps us to know the exact result, we will obtain in doing certain operations. For example, the complete and definite knowledge of powder flow properties helps us in different operations such as compression, transportation etc. These powder flow properties can further be measured using various metrics. Some of the most popular and most useful properties which are used to predict the behavior of flow of powders are powder cohesion, the dynamic angle of repose, powder compressibility, Carr's index and Hausner ratio. Various instruments are used to measure and predict these properties accurately such as Powder Rheometer, Bulk density testers, powder flow testers and much more. Let us dive deep and get an overview of each of these properties. 1. Powder Cohesion Powder Cohesion is defined as sticking together of particles of the same substance. The particles tend to collect together or attract each other. They exert attractive forces towards each other called the Wander Waal’s forces. This is an important factor that determines the powder flow. Another type of attractive force that the particles can exert is an electrostatic force. This property signifies how the powder will flow through hoppers. Too much attractive forces inhibit the flow. 2. The Dynamic Angle of Repose There are two kinds of angles of repose that affect powder flow properties, static and dynamic angle of repose. Here we will consider the dynamic angle of repose. rnDynamic angle of repose is the angle observed when the powder particles are moving continuously downwards on an inclined slope. Different angles of repose exert different effects on the powder flow properties. Different angles are associated with the size of the particles present in the powder. 3. Powder Compressibility This is yet again an important factor which determines the powder flow. The powder compressibility is the ability of particles present in the sample of powder to shrink or compress in volume when pressure is applied. In other words, a material’s compressibility is its bulk density/pressure relationship. 4. Wall Friction The flowability of powder is also largely dependant on external factors such as the friction between the walls of the container they are flowing through and the particles of the powder. Wall friction affects the angle of the hopper and it is required to be designed keeping the wall friction in mind. Taking account of this property, the shape of the hopper is decided whether it will be shaped as a cone or a wedge because wall friction dictates the mass flow. 5. Powder Rheometers These instruments are capable of measuring the shear, bulk and various above mentioned dynamic properties of a powder. The powder samples are analyzed for various different conditions like consolidated, conditioned or even in the fluidic state leading to a full exploration of various properties. With the advent of sensitive instruments like Powder Rheometers, measuring the powder flow properties has become accurate. The knowledge of powder flow properties is very vital if we want our system to run at maximum efficiency
